Variational Low-rank Tensor Decomposition for Multisubject Spatiotemporal Data Analysis

Read the original on arXiv Machine Learning →

arXiv:2607. 22262v1 Announce Type: cross Abstract: Modeling shared and subject-specific structure in multisubject spatiotemporal data remains challenging, particularly in neuroimaging, where both spatial and temporal patterns exhibit rich variability across subjects.
